Summary
The distressing tale of Kendall Maycock unfolds as a poignant narrative of a resilient young single mother grappling with the formidable challenges life has thrown her way. Her journey, marked by the trials of an unexpected early pregnancy and the daunting reality of homelessness, paints a vivid picture of her struggle against the odds.
Kendall's life, already steeped in hardship, veered into an even more perilous direction when she encountered Harold Franklin Brodie, a man whose history was tainted by criminal activities. Initially, Harold presented himself as a benevolent figure, extending an offer of assistance to the beleaguered young woman. However, his true intentions soon surfaced as he began to make unwelcome and inappropriate advances toward her.
The situation escalated tragically when Harold assaulted Kendall, a harrowing experience that left her battered and abandoned on the side of a desolate road. In this critical moment of vulnerability, her plight was witnessed by compassionate passersby who intervened, providing her with the much-needed help and ultimately saving her from further peril.
The aftermath of the assault saw the mobilization of law enforcement as a thorough police investigation was launched, meticulously piecing together the events that led to the attack. The diligent efforts of the authorities culminated in the apprehension and arrest of Harold, bringing a measure of justice to the ordeal that Kendall had endured.
